摘要:
The nonlinear optical Kerr effect, acting on optical pulses in fibres, creates spectral sidebands and noise correlations between these sidebands. The reduction of photon-number fluctuations of these pulses below the shot-noise limit by spectral filtering is well established in the anomalous dispersion regime which allows for soliton formation. Here it is demonstrated that a significant quantum-noise reduction with spectral filtering can also be reached for pulses in the normal dispersion regime. The filter function was optimized and the power dependence of the noise reduction was investigated. The best squeezing result is (1.2 ± 0.2) dB (corresponding to (2.6 ± 0.7) dB inferred for 100% detection efficiency).

摘要:
The steady-state population behaviour in a laser driven V-type system has been analysed. The effects of spontaneous emission-induced coherence and of the relative phase of the two coherent driving fields are considered in detail. A large and unexpected population inversion is found on one of the optical transitions due to these coherent effects.

摘要:
New methods for the production of blazed relief grating profiles using grating masks with either binary or harmonic transmittance have been developed. These methods are based on the recording of a scanning wave, properly modulated by a mask, through a grating period into photoresist. The applicability of the gratings produced by this method would be especially in the infrared or near-infrared wavelength regions in the reflection mode. These methods have been theoretically analysed and the principal ideas of the methods were experimentally verified.

摘要:
In this paper we present one method for the characterization of the spatial light modulators (SLMs) of a real-time Vander Lugt type of correlator. This correlator uses two SLMs: one to introduce the scene and a second to introduce the frequency‐matched filter. The SLM characterization methods arein situ, that is in the correlator set‐up. Illumination conditions are different for each SLM, and consequently different characterization techniques must be used in each case. For the characterization of the scene SLM a diffraction method is used, while for the characterization of the filter SLM an interferometric technique is more convenient. Finally, we take into account the operating curves of scene and filter SLMs in the design of the filter in order to optimize the correlation peak.

摘要:
In a one-atom micromaser, the expression for the density matrix of the cavity field without the rotating-wave approximation (RWA) is derived using a perturbation method. The phase evolution of the cavity field is investigated without the RWA, and the results are compared with those within the RWA. It is shown that the virtual-photon processes make the symmetric phase distribution in the RWA asymmetric and cause additional quantum oscillation, which indicate the field's phase fluctuation and frequency shift. Virtual photons also cause an extra phase distribution to the field which is initially in a vacuum state. The unique characteristic of the phase properties in the course of forming a photon-number state is investigated. Other new phenomena such as the undamped oscillation of the phase variance against the injected atomic number are found.

摘要:
First-order nonspecular effects for Gaussian beams reflected on the first interface of a system formed by two interfaces of isotropic materials are studied. The complex lateral displacement is analytically determined and the validity of the approximations made is analysed. It is shown that the lateral displacement is independent of the beam waist and the approximation results suitable even for very narrow beams near Brewster's condition. With a dielectric-metal-dielectric configuration (Kretschmann's) and under resonance conditions, lateral displacements of up to 25% of the beam width can be obtained.

摘要:
A set of general formulae for paraxial ray tracing in inhomogeneous media are derived, which can be used together with the aberration formulae by Sands for the first- and third-order analyses of inhomogeneous lenses of all kinds of gradient function. The choice of an optimum step size for paraxial ray tracing and aberration integration is discussed, and it is shown that results with good accuracy can be obtained with a relatively large step size and very economic computing effort, even for complex gradient functions such as the tapered hyperbolic secant.

摘要:
Recently it was predicted that addition of spherical aberration to a focusing system with a small Fresnel number can increase the value of the maximum intensity on the optical axis. In this paper we report experiments which confirm this prediction. To this end we have measured the three-dimensional intensity distribution in the focal region of a lens with spherical aberration. We also show that this effectcannotbe used to increase the intensity at a fixed distance from the lens.

摘要:
We present a detailed theory of a two-photon micromaser and study the properties of the photon field in this system. The Hamiltonian of twophoton processes is obtained by an exact unitary transformation from that of a three-level atom interacting with a single-mode field. We discuss trapping states and the realization of a photon number state.
